An arranged marriage between a woman desperate to belong to herself and a man who belonged more to revolutions than to love.
Born with privilege but disgusted by the society around him, As a criminal lawyer, he fought for widows, young girls, and women whose voices were buried.
Marriage was never meant to be part of his life until a promise brought them together as husband and wife.
He belonged to nobility, precise in words, calm in demeanor and observant. She belonged only to herself, spoke words of her shadow.
Stepping into his grand haveli as his wife forced her to face harsh customs, lingering judgments, and a marriage filled with quiet tension, stolen glances, and feelings neither of them were ready to name.
And when society tries to break her spirit, will he stand beside the world he swore to change or set her dreamson fire for his family ?
